  19. D

    Vacation charging

    ...leave it plugged in. Charging to 100% and leaving the car to sit at that SOC is absolutely not best practice. Long periods at 100% SOC will accelerate battery degradation. This is why a maximum charge level of 80% is recommended for daily driving. Charge to 100% only at the start of a long trip.
